Definitions
- A language exercise in which one or more words are replaced with a blank line and the reader is tasked with supplying a valid replacement.
-
A placeholder allowing for any of a variety of possible answers or a single elicited answer. figuratively, idiomatic

Examples
“The test consisted of fill-in-the-blank sentences.”
“The emphasis on doing the Bible study portion. This is not a fill in the blank with a simple answer from the Bible that “says” what we are looking for.”
“It was important that she make something memorable. She wanted to be complimented. She wanted people to go home after the party and say, “Wasn't Dorothy's — fill in the blank — amazing?"”
